Aureo sale 261, lot 756

This specimen was lot 756 in Aureo sale 261 (Barcelona, July 2014), where it sold for €370 (about US$594 with buyer's fees). The catalog description[1] noted,

"1767. Alemania. Frankfurt. G PCB N. 1 taler. Plata ligeramente agria. Bella. (EBC-). (Germany, city of Frankfurt, silver thaler of 1767. Planchet flaws, handsome, about extremely fine.)"

This type is listed for 1766-67 and is rather scarce.

Recorded mintage: unknown.

Specification: silver.

Catalog reference: Dav-2225; KM-246.
